Indian River Tops Volleyball, 3-0
FORT PIERCE, Fla. – Santa Fe College Volleyball traveled south to play Indian River State College on Saturday afternoon, and the Pioneers prevailed by a 3-0 margin, 25-19, 25-16, 25-20.
Set 1 – IRSC 25, SF 19
The Saints scored seven of the match's first ten points, but the Pioneers were able to quickly work their way back even.
The score was tied at 10-10 when the hosts began a 5-0 run to gain separation, and SF was never able to get any closer than three points away from the Pioneers the rest of the way.
Set 2 – IRSC 25, SF 16
The Saints started slowly in the second set and fell behind 9-4 before taking a timeout.
Later, SF trailed 16-13, and appeared to have found some things that were effective against IRSC.
The Pioneers, however, jumped in front 2-0 on the strength of a 9-3 run to conclude the second set.
Set 3 – IRSC 25, SF 20
The Saints' block came alive at the start of the third, and the two sides went back-and-forth.
Three unanswered points put IRSC in front 12-9, and their lead eventually swelled to as large as six, 21-15.
Despite the Saints' efforts in what proved to be the concluding stretch of play, IRSC earned the final point of the sweep with a tip kill.
Key Saints' Statistic
The Saints set a season-high mark with 15 total blocks.
